黑狐家游戏

数据挖掘导论完整版课后答案第二章,数据挖掘导论第二章,数据预处理方法及应用解析

欧气 0 0

本文目录导读:

数据挖掘导论完整版课后答案第二章,数据挖掘导论第二章,数据预处理方法及应用解析

图片来源于网络,如有侵权联系删除

  1. 数据预处理概述
  2. 数据清洗方法及应用
  3. 数据集成方法及应用
  4. 数据变换方法及应用
  5. 数据归约方法及应用

在数据挖掘的过程中,数据预处理是一个至关重要的步骤,它不仅关系到数据挖掘算法的执行效率,更直接影响到挖掘结果的准确性和可靠性,本章将深入探讨数据预处理的基本方法,并分析其在实际应用中的重要作用。

数据预处理概述

数据预处理是指在数据挖掘前对数据进行的一系列处理操作,旨在提高数据质量、降低数据复杂性,为后续的数据挖掘提供高质量的数据基础,数据预处理主要包括以下内容:

1、数据清洗:消除数据中的错误、异常、重复等不良信息,提高数据准确性。

2、数据集成:将来自不同来源、不同结构的数据进行整合,形成统一的数据格式。

3、数据变换:对数据进行规范化、归一化等操作,提高数据挖掘算法的适用性。

4、数据归约:通过降维、采样等方法减少数据规模,提高数据挖掘效率。

数据清洗方法及应用

数据清洗是数据预处理的首要任务,以下列举几种常见的数据清洗方法:

1、填空处理:对于缺失值,可以根据数据类型、上下文等信息进行填充,如平均值、中位数、众数等。

2、异常值处理:对于异常值,可以采用剔除、替换、修正等方法进行处理。

3、重复数据处理:通过去重操作,消除数据中的重复记录。

4、数据类型转换:将不同数据类型的数据转换为统一类型,便于后续处理。

数据清洗在实际应用中具有以下作用:

(1)提高数据质量:通过清洗数据,降低数据错误、异常等不良信息对挖掘结果的影响。

(2)降低计算复杂度:清洗后的数据更加简洁,有助于降低数据挖掘算法的计算复杂度。

数据挖掘导论完整版课后答案第二章,数据挖掘导论第二章,数据预处理方法及应用解析

图片来源于网络,如有侵权联系删除

(3)提高挖掘效率:数据清洗有助于提高数据挖掘算法的执行效率,缩短挖掘时间。

数据集成方法及应用

数据集成是将来自不同来源、不同结构的数据进行整合的过程,以下列举几种常见的数据集成方法:

1、数据合并:将具有相同字段的数据进行合并,形成统一的数据格式。

2、数据映射:将不同数据源中的字段进行映射,实现数据之间的关联。

3、数据抽取:从多个数据源中抽取所需字段,形成新的数据集。

数据集成在实际应用中具有以下作用:

(1)提高数据可用性:通过集成数据,提高数据在各个领域的可用性。

(2)降低数据冗余:集成数据有助于降低数据冗余,减少数据存储空间。

(3)提高挖掘效率:集成后的数据更加统一,有助于提高数据挖掘算法的执行效率。

数据变换方法及应用

数据变换是对原始数据进行规范化、归一化等操作,以提高数据挖掘算法的适用性,以下列举几种常见的数据变换方法:

1、标准化:将数据缩放到特定范围,如[-1, 1]或[0, 1]。

2、归一化:将数据转换为0到1之间的值。

3、二值化:将数据转换为0或1两个值。

数据变换在实际应用中具有以下作用:

数据挖掘导论完整版课后答案第二章,数据挖掘导论第二章,数据预处理方法及应用解析

图片来源于网络,如有侵权联系删除

(1)提高数据质量:通过数据变换,降低数据之间的差异,提高数据挖掘算法的准确性。

(2)提高挖掘效率:变换后的数据更加适合某些数据挖掘算法,有助于提高挖掘效率。

(3)提高数据可视化效果:数据变换有助于提高数据可视化效果,便于分析。

数据归约方法及应用

数据归约是通过降维、采样等方法减少数据规模,以提高数据挖掘效率,以下列举几种常见的数据归约方法:

1、降维:通过主成分分析(PCA)、因子分析等方法,将多个变量转化为少数几个主成分。

2、采样:通过随机采样、分层采样等方法,减少数据规模。

数据归约在实际应用中具有以下作用:

(1)提高挖掘效率:通过减少数据规模,降低数据挖掘算法的计算复杂度,提高挖掘效率。

(2)降低存储成本:减少数据规模,降低数据存储成本。

(3)提高数据挖掘质量:通过归约,降低数据冗余,提高数据挖掘质量。

数据预处理在数据挖掘过程中具有举足轻重的作用,掌握数据预处理的基本方法,对于提高数据挖掘质量、降低挖掘成本具有重要意义。

标签: #数据挖掘导论完整版课后答案

黑狐家游戏
  • 评论列表

留言评论